The trajectory of digital transformation offers a cautionary tale that AI could easily repeat. In many organizations, the initial wave of digitization amounted to converting paper forms into web pages, moving meetings to video conferencing, and lifting legacy applications onto cloud servers—while the underlying logic of those processes remained untouched. AI today is being applied in a similar fashion, with popular use cases centered on meeting summarization, content generation, basic customer service bots, automated code writing, ticket routing, queue reduction, and repetitive task elimination. These applications undoubtedly remove friction and free up human capacity for higher‑order work, yet they often originate from the same narrow question: how can AI help us do what we already do more efficiently? When that question dominates, there is little room to consider whether the task itself should exist in an AI‑augmented world, or whether a completely different customer journey could now be imagined. Without deliberately stepping beyond this pattern, AI risks becoming merely a turbocharger for outdated workflows.
A genuine mindshift goes beyond superficial openness to change; it entails a deep reorientation of perspective that allows leaders to perceive opportunities previously obscured by entrenched habits and experiences. Experience, while valuable, can also act as a lens that filters out radical possibilities. To cultivate this mindset, I introduced the concept of WWAID—What Would AI Do?—as a pre‑prompt discipline that forces leaders to reconsider the problem before seeking an algorithmic solution. Rather than asking how AI can accelerate a given step, WWAID encourages asking why a particular process takes so long, why customers repeatedly provide information the company already holds, why workflows fracture across disconnected systems, and why talented employees spend excessive time reconciling data or navigating complexity. Only after probing these “why” questions does the transformative “what if” emerge: what if we did not have to operate this way at all? This inversion opens the door to redesigning experiences around desired outcomes rather than legacy constraints.
In practice, organizations must pursue two complementary tracks simultaneously. The first, iterative AI, focuses on refining existing services and eliminating routine chores. By automating repetitive tasks, reducing operational complexity, and surfacing insights faster, iterative AI helps employees make better decisions and devote more time to strategic, creative, or empathetic work. This track is essential because many enterprises still contend with fragmented IT landscapes, manual handoffs, accumulated technical debt, and workflows that have ossified over decades. The second track, innovative AI, leverages intelligence to create wholly new capabilities, experiences, products, services, or business models. Rather than tweaking the current value chain, innovative AI can redefine how value is conceived, produced, and delivered, opening pathways to exponential growth and market disruption. Sustainable success requires balancing both curves: the steady, incremental gains of iteration paired with the bold, potentially exponential leaps of innovation.
The financial benefits derived from automation—cost savings, increased throughput, and improved productivity—should not be funneled exclusively into further cost‑cutting initiatives. Instead, leaders ought to recycle a portion of those gains into people, experimentation, augmentation, and broader business reinvention. This approach challenges the traditional ROI mantra of “automate work, cut costs accordingly,” which can inadvertently starve the organization of the resources needed to explore future‑oriented opportunities. When efficiency improvements are hoarded purely for margin enhancement, a company may become exceptionally proficient at operating a model that is steadily losing relevance in the face of evolving customer preferences and competitive pressures. By contrast, reinvesting automation dividends into pilot projects, skill development, and exploratory AI initiatives builds the capacity to invent tomorrow’s growth engines while still delivering today’s performance.
Augmentation represents a more sophisticated partnership between humans and AI than simple task replacement. In this model, AI functions as a cognitive exoskeleton, amplifying human expertise, sharpening decision‑making, and expanding creative potential. The objective is not to eliminate human involvement indiscriminately, but to redesign the workflow so that people and machines each contribute where they excel. For instance, AI might handle vast data aggregation and pattern recognition, while humans apply contextual judgment, ethical reasoning, and interpersonal empathy. This symbiosis elevates the overall capability of the workforce, enabling outcomes that neither pure human effort nor autonomous machines could achieve alone. Effective augmentation requires clear delineation of responsibilities, continuous feedback loops, and a culture that views AI as a collaborator rather than a threat.
The evolution continues with agentic AI, where software agents acquire the ability to interpret context, interact with multiple systems, coordinate interdependent tasks, adapt to shifting conditions, and act within predefined boundaries. Over time, an increasing share of workflows will operate with a high degree of autonomy, overseen by human supervisors who focus on exception handling, strategic direction, and continuous learning. This shift has profound implications for organizational design. Traditional hierarchies, built around human shift schedules, departmental silos, and sequential hand‑offs, begin to loosen as agents can work around the clock and bridge functional divides without friction. The result is a move toward an always‑on enterprise that responds in real‑time to events rather than being constrained by calendar‑based planning cycles. Leaders must therefore reconsider org charts, reporting lines, and even the relationship between company size and market influence, as both large incumbents and agile newcomers gain new levers of scale and responsiveness.

To translate these ideas into action, start by identifying a meaningful outcome that matters to your customers, employees, or broader business goals. Map the end‑to‑end workflow that currently delivers that outcome, pinpointing points of friction, fragmentation, and outdated assumptions that impede performance. Assemble a cross‑functional team that includes business owners, process experts, data stewards, technologists, and representatives of the human impact to collectively reimagine the flow from scratch. Rather than asking, “Where can we insert AI?” begin with the question, “What outcome should now be possible, and why are we not already delivering it?” Let the answer guide experiments with both iterative and innovative AI applications, measure results not only in efficiency gains but also in new value creation, and continually reinvest a share of those gains into further exploration.
